Apple's AirPods are more than just a trendy accessory; they come packed with a variety of unique features that enhance the listening experience. For instance, did you know that AirPods offer seamless device switching? This means that you can easily switch between your iPhone, iPad, or Mac without any manual intervention, allowing you to enjoy your music or take calls without missing a beat. Additionally, the spatial audio feature provides a surround sound experience, allowing you to feel as though you're in the center of the audio, making movies and games more immersive than ever.
Another standout feature is the automatic ear detection. AirPods can sense when they're in your ears and will automatically start playing music or taking calls when you put them in and pause when you remove them. This smart technology not only conserves battery life but also enhances user convenience. Furthermore, with the Find My feature integrated, you can easily track down your AirPods if they are misplaced, saving you from the frustration of searching for lost items. These features, combined with their sleek design, make AirPods an exceptional choice for audio lovers everywhere.

When evaluating whether AirPods are worth the hype, it's essential to consider several factors. Sound quality is generally rated highly, but some audiophiles may find them lacking in richness compared to over-ear models. Additionally, their notable battery life and the charging case's portability offer substantial perks for users on the go. On the downside, the price point tends to be higher than similar products, leading many to question if the added features justify the cost. Ultimately, the decision comes down to personal preference and how much value one places on the AirPods’ distinctive features.
